Raspberry Pi 2 model B

Today was the day I received the latest Raspberry Pi, the version 2, model B.  This version is a significant upgrade from the version 2, model B+ with a 4 core processor and 1GB of memory.  Same footprint as the v1 B+ so all the cases that accommodate the B+ will also accommodate the new version 2.  And the speed is notable over my original v1 B (256mB memory, single core processor).

All storage on the low cost Raspberry Pi is via an SD or micro SD card (the original was an SD card, the B+ version changed to microSD and is retained for the v2 B).  So it is somewhat slow, but very acceptable.

Using a concept called NOOBS (New Out of the Box System), one can choose which of several operating systems to install on the microSD card.  I chose the Raspbian Operating System, a Debian Wheezy variant.

Setup is fairly easy…put the Raspberry Pi in a case for protection, connect keyboard and mouse to the USB ports, connect a display via the HDMI port, and connect power.  Networking via a cable is available too, or one can use a USB plug-in for Wi-Fi.  All-in-all for $35 for the Pi (add for shipping), about $8 to $20 for a case, and a few dollars for the microSD (8BG probably the minimum) and you’re ready to start.

CASE: From a variety of cases available on Amazon I selected the FLIRC case.  Basically a case metalic shell with plastic bottom and a nice top.  While not transparent like some of the plastic cases, it is really nice.  A little expensive at about $19 than the $8 plastic cases, but it is very nice looking and helps dissipate any heat build up. (Note: I originally paid $13 for the case and over the two weeks Amazon moved the price to $17 then to $19, back to $17, and back to $19). My rating for the FLIRC case design for Raspberry Pi 2 — 5 out of 5 stars.

HDMI to VGA:  To use a conventional LCD monitor, the video needs to convert the HDMI to VGA, I’m using a dongle from Ableconn (about $18).  Easy to connect to the VGA cable and mate the HDMI end on the Pi. My rating for the Ablecon dongle for Raspberry Pi 2 — 5 out of 5 stars.

Wi-FiAlthough the Pi has a 10/100 ethernet port, I wanted to “cut the cord” so I can play with the Pi anyplace in the house.  The Edimax small footprint wi-fi plug-in appeared in many pictures of the various Pi projects.  So I gave it a try (about $9) and have NOT been disappointed.  With the 4 USB ports on the Pi it doesn’t consume a lot of space (in the original Pi, there were only 2 USB ports, the B+ and now v2 B have 4 ports). My rating for the Edimax wi-fi dongle for Raspberry Pi 2 — 5 out of 5 stars.

Operating SystemAs mentioned, I’m using Raspbian Linux, a Debian variant. It has the various Linux components one needs to begin immediately, but Linux itself requires some discipline and it is different from Windows such as case sensitivity for file names and folders.  Also, the default web browser doesn’t display sites the same way as other browsers display the same page.    My rating for the Raspian OS for Raspberry Pi 2 — 4 out of 5 stars.

Several years ago, in my role as an Enterprise Architect, we began to see a demand from various business components to leverage use of the growing popularity of Apple’s iPad in another example of consumer driven IT.  At the same time, Apple started to introduce the iPad2 making the iPad1 available at a discount.  Additionally, leveraging an additional discount for a refurbished model, I acquired an iPad1.

And so began my discovery of iPad technology.  I used the iPad as a note taking platform during several conferences and discovered some of the quirks of the Apple IOS operating system.  Unlike Windows and even the Android platforms, IOS does not have a visible file structure!  I did not realize this until I was at a conference taking notes with the iPad note application…a full day’s notes were instantly vaporized with some keystroke sequence I accidentally activated. Up until that time, I was sending the notes back home via e-mail (apparently the only way to preserve them) at the end of the day…lesson learned, do it hourly! (I believe you can also deposit the contents in Dropbox, but I’m not a big user of this service).

As I learned more about the iPad technology I configured it with various news applications as well as the solitaire application.  It served me well as a browser to catch up with the morning news, to pass the time.  At some point, my e-mail settings got lost and while I was able to read my e-mails, I could not send any…not much of a loss for my use.

As time goes on, Apple upgraded the IOS operating system from v5 to versions 7 and 8.  However, the iPad1 was limited to version 5.x.  As Apple introduced newer versions of the iPad and other IOS devices, applications began to leverage new capabilities of IOS especially v7.x.  Applications on the iPad1 gradually became obsolete and could no longer be upgraded.  Also, applications often crashed the operating system, especially with embedded content using pictures…in essence, my iPad1 was doing its equivalent to a “blue screen of death.”

Wanting to keep somewhat current with iPad-like technology, I sought out newer options.  First off, it had to run IOS v7 or v8.  I didn’t need all the latest features, and I wanted to manage the cost.  Apple had introduced the iPad Mini and currently has 3 generations of such.  I looked at both the iPad Mini 3 and the iPad Mini 2.  I found the screen size acceptible and the high resolution of the screen (“retina”) was nice.  I didn’t need the regular sized iPad (9″) and the smaller Mini was workable for my needs.  I settled on the iPad Mini 2, searched for refurbished or sale and found a good price at a local Microcenter computer store.

IOS hasn’t changed in some functionality limitations I’ve seen before – no visible file system.  But the smaller sized iPad Mini 2 was easy to carry, held its battery charge reasonably well, my applications ported over easy.  Additionally I was able to set up the e-mail accounts, so my reading e-mails was maintained…but in addition, I figured out how to sent e-mails although the iPad is not my primary approach to sending e-mails.

As with my previous iPad1 note taking, the ability to take notes with some formatting – like bullets – is not possible; one must use various manual characters to simulate bullets (such as a “*”), then e-mail the content, then copy into a more suitable word processor.

Lenovo Thinkpad 11e (Part 2 – Chrome Operating System

Note:  In any assessment of operating systems and application suites. YOUR functional use is the most important factor.  Some people need high performance, some don’t; some people need sophisticated applications, some can easily use simple applications;.  It all depends on one’s needs.  These products are viewed from the perspective of my usage and needs.

I’ve used the Lenovo Thinkpad 11e for several months now and continue to like the platform itself.  However, I don’t fully enjoy (appreciate) the Chrome Operating System for my needs.  I need to emphasize that my opinion of Chrome is as it applies to my specific use and needs, not the totality of the operating system.

First off, one must be connected to the Internet and logged into Google to make good use of the Chrome OS it is a browser-based operation including the multitude of applications available via the Google Store.  So if you’re in an area where no network connection is available, all that hardware you’re tugging around is non-functional since all the applications leverage the Chrome Browser (which by itself is not bad and definitely better than most versions of Internet Explorer I’ve used); and of course any browser requires Internet connectivity.

Unlike the Apple IOS, Chrome does a visible file system and permits storage of files locally or in the Google cloud.   While connectivity to other clouds – such as Microsoft’s OneDrive – is possible, operating on a document in OneDrive requires moving that file locally or to the Google Cloud in order to operate on it.

Applications for the ChromeOS are somewhat limited.  When compared with the applications available for the Android operating system, the number/kinds of applications available for the Chrome OS are limited – although a few “local” utilities are available.

Even with network connectivity to the Internet at home, I have not found it possible to access files stored on local network attached storage.

Additionally, I haven’t been able to print documents on my network connected printers (haven’t tried locally connected printer either).  Supposedly there is a way to connect to your home printers if they are connected to the Internet via a Google Cloud Printing service — but so far it seems too complicated and I have not evaluated the security implications.
